Are photons electrons?
No, photons are not electrons. Photons are elementary particles that make up light and electromagnetic radiation, while electrons are negatively charged subatomic particles that are part of atoms. Photons have no mass and travel at the speed of light, while electrons have mass and are bound to the nucleus of an atom. **
What happens to photons?
Photons are elementary particles that make up light. They do not have mass and travel at the speed of light. When photons interact with matter, they can be absorbed, reflected, or transmitted. Absorption of photons can result in the excitation of electrons, leading to various physical and chemical processes. **

How are photons created?
Photons are created through a process called electromagnetic radiation. This occurs when an atom absorbs energy, causing its electrons to move to a higher energy level. When the electrons return to their original energy level, they release the absorbed energy in the form of photons. This process can happen in various ways, such as through thermal radiation, chemical reactions, or nuclear reactions. **

How can one convert the energy of different photons into monochromatic photons?
One way to convert the energy of different photons into monochromatic photons is through a process called frequency doubling or second harmonic generation. This involves passing the photons through a nonlinear crystal, which causes the photons to combine and create new photons with double the frequency and half the wavelength of the original photons. This results in monochromatic photons with a single, specific wavelength. Another method is through the use of filters or monochromators, which can selectively filter out photons of specific wavelengths, allowing only monochromatic photons to pass through. **

How far do photons travel?
Photons, as particles of light, travel at the speed of light in a vacuum, which is approximately 299,792 kilometers per second. This means that photons can travel vast distances in a very short amount of time. However, their travel distance can be affected by factors such as absorption, reflection, and scattering, which can cause them to be absorbed or redirected before reaching their destination. **

What distinguishes photons and protons?
Photons are elementary particles that carry electromagnetic radiation, such as light, while protons are subatomic particles found in the nucleus of an atom. Photons have no mass and travel at the speed of light, while protons have mass and are composed of quarks. Additionally, photons do not have an electric charge, while protons have a positive electric charge. **

How can photons have mass?
Photons are massless particles according to the Standard Model of particle physics. They travel at the speed of light and have zero rest mass. However, in certain theoretical models beyond the Standard Model, such as some versions of string theory, it is possible for photons to acquire a small amount of mass through interactions with other particles or fields. This mass is typically very small and has not been experimentally observed. **
